    ON SUA SPONTE RECONSIDERATION

    BY THE COURT:

    1

    On the Court's own motion, a majority of the judges in active service having voted in favor of rehearing this appeal en banc,

    2

    IT IS ORDERED that the mandate issued on July 11, 1986, is RECALLED and that this case shall be heard by this court sitting en banc, with oral argument on a date hereafter to be fixed. The clerk will specify a briefing schedule for the filing of en banc briefs.

    3

    The previous panel's opinion and the order entered on December 2, 1985, denying rehearing and rehearing en banc are VACATED.
